What Are Literature Circle Role Sheets?
Literature Circle Role Sheets are educational tools designed to enhance group discussions around books in classroom settings. These role sheets define specific responsibilities, facilitating structured engagement among students. Each sheet includes various roles, such as Discussion Director, Connector, and others, enabling effective collaboration and deeper understanding of the text.
Benefits of Using Literature Circle Role Sheets
The advantages of employing Literature Circle Role Sheets are significant for both teachers and students. First, they enhance engagement and accountability during discussions. Second, these role sheets encourage the exploration of diverse perspectives, fostering a deeper comprehension of the material. Additionally, they play a crucial role in developing critical thinking and communication skills among students.
